PRODUCER:
Established in 1860, Tahbilk is an historic family-owned winery, renowned for its rare aged Marsanne. The estate has the world’s largest single holding of the varietal and produces Marsanne from vines established in 1927, which are among the oldest in the world. Tahbilk is known as ‘tabilk tabilk’ in the language of the Daungwurrung clans, which translates as the ‘place of many waterholes’. It perfectly describes this premium viticultural landscape, which is located in the Nagambie Lakes region of Central Victoria. The estate comprises 1,214 hectares, including a seven mile frontage to the Goulburn River. Environmental sustainability is paramount at Tahbilk and in 2013 they became carbon neutral. In 2016, Tahbilk was awarded ‘Winery of the Year’ by James Halliday.

VINEYARD:
Tahbilk’s vineyards are grouped along the banks of the Goulburn River and an anabranch of it which flows through the estate. The water has a tempering influence on the climate. The vines are grown at approximately 134 metres above sea level on gently undulating and flat terrain. The soils are sandy loam with ferric oxide content, which varies from very fine sand near the anabranch to denser loams on the plains. The grapes come from the single vineyard Madills 1927 block, where the vines planted before 1986 are on ARG rootstocks. They are trained on a single wire trellis with a mixture of head and cordon training, with cane and spur pruning. Tahbilk’s vines are sustainably cultivated; composting and mulching take place, which improves soil health by promoting earthworm activity. Mulching also helps to control weeds and conserves water, reducing vine stress.

WINEMAKING:
The hand-picked grapes were handled semi-oxidatively; controlled amounts of oxygen were allowed, which helped impart secondary flavours and texture to the wine. Fermentation took place with selected neutral and aromatic yeasts at cool temperatures and lasted for 20 days in stainless steel fermenters to enhance the purity of the fruit. Made with naturally high acidity to support serious long-term ageing, it was matured in a bottle for six years.

VINTAGE:
2016 was a condensed vintage, with the warmest growing season on record. A dry winter and spring were interrupted by a significant thunderstorm in January, which hit some of the old vineyards. Warm weather returned soon after, resulting in an early vintage, good to very good in terms of quality and quantity, delivering crisp and delicate white wines.

TASTING NOTE:
Complex aromas of lemon and orange are accompanied by fresh hay overtones. Notes of lemon, grapefruit, toast and classic rich honeysuckle weave through the rich and textured palate, beautifully balanced by a zesty finish.

GRAPES:
Marsanne 100%.
